General information and overview
The Triumph Bonneville T120 Chrome Edition is a standout in the modern classic motorcycle segment, combining the timeless appeal of the original 1959 Bonneville with modern engineering and features. Powered by a 1197cc parallel-twin engine with a 270-degree crank, this bike offers a smooth and powerful ride, with peak torque of 77 ft-lbs available at just 3500 rpm. The bike features a 6-speed transmission, liquid cooling, and a wet multiplate clutch with an assist function. The chassis is designed for stability, with a 25.5-degree rake and a 57-inch wheelbase, making it predictable and forgiving on various road conditions. Additional features include ABS, traction control, ride-by-wire throttle, and two riding modes Rain and Road. The bike also boasts a classic analogue twin-pod instrument cluster, heated grips, and a weatherproof USB port. With its comfortable seating position, manageable 31-inch seat height, and robust build quality, the T120 is an excellent choice for both beginners and seasoned riders looking for a versatile and enjoyable riding experience.

The Triumph Bonneville T120 Chrome Edition, part of the 2023 Chrome Collection, has been making waves with its stunning new look. The bike features a flawlessly chromed fuel tank surrounded by iconic Meriden Blue, contrasting with Jet Black mudguards, headlight bowl, and side panels. This limited edition also includes a matching Meriden Blue accessory fly screen for added style and comfort. I think this cosmetic upgrade really elevates the classic Bonneville design.
The Bonneville T120 Chrome Edition is not just about looks; it also delivers on performance. The bike features 41mm cartridge forks, preload-adjustable twin rear suspension units, and twin Brembo front brake calipers with ABS, ensuring dynamic agility and neutral handling. This combination of style and performance makes it an attractive option for both casual riders and enthusiasts. I think the balance between style and performance is what sets this bike apart.

Pricing details and changes
In India, the Triumph Bonneville T120 Chrome Edition is priced around 11.09 lakh ex-showroom. When you factor in the on-road costs, including registration, insurance, and other local taxes, the price can escalate to approximately 13.5 lakh to 14.5 lakh, depending on the state and city. This pricing reflects the bikes premium build quality, advanced features, and the brands reputation for delivering high-performance motorcycles. While it may seem steep, the T120 offers a unique blend of classic styling and modern technology that justifies the investment for those seeking a distinctive and capable motorcycle.
Triumph Bonneville T120 Chrome Edition on road price is Rs 13.69 lakh in Delhi, Rs 14.15 lakh in Mumbai, Rs 13.85 lakh in Kolkata and Rs 14.03 lakh in Chennai. Ex-Showroom Price is the Manufacturing Cost of the vehicle + Dealer/Seller Profit + GST (Goods and Service Tax) + Transportation Charges (from the manufacturing plant to the dealership). On the other hand, the On-Road Price is the actual cost you pay to the dealership to make the vehicle legal to run on the roads. It includes Ex-Showroom Price in your city + RTO Charges (Vehicle Registration) + One Time Road Tax + Insurance Charges. The On-Road Price also includes some optional things like if you opt for Genuine Accessories and Extended Warranty while buying a vehicle. Please note that the On-Road Price varies a lot across different states in India due to different percentage for the State Registration Charges.
Fuel efficiency information
The mileage of the Triumph Bonneville T120 Chrome Edition in India is generally respectable for a bike of its size and power output. You can expect an average fuel efficiency of around 18-22 kml in mixed riding conditions, which includes both city traffic and highway cruising. This figure can vary based on riding style, road conditions, and the specific terrain. Given its 14.5-liter fuel tank, the T120 can cover a significant distance before needing a refill, making it suitable for long rides without frequent stops. However, the actual mileage may differ slightly depending on how aggressively you ride and the specific conditions you encounter.
